March 7, 2018 Reality Check Game Show, Titan Café, 12:40-1:40 p.m. Reality Check is a fast-paced trivia program that gives students a chance to show off their knowledge in an elimination-style program. Questions involve some current events, pop culture, and random facts, as well as a strong emphasis relating to drug and alcohol awareness & sexual assault prevention. Cash Prizes!

Dear Prospective Graduate: As Commencement Day nears, Community College of Beaver County is finalizing preparations for the traditional ceremonies designated to celebrate your academic achievements. If you haven’t already done so, apply for graduation! IT’S FREE! Students interested in graduating should complete the application for graduation found on the students tab when logged in to my.ccbc.edu. The 2018 Commencement ceremony is scheduled for Thursday, May 3, 2018 at 6:00 p.m. in the Athletics & Event Center (Dome).
The Community College of Beaver County shares your pride in this educational milestone. Plan to participate; Commencement 2018 is your ceremony of celebration.
Also, please confirm your participation in the ceremony by completing and submitting the Commencement RSVP form at www.ccbc.edu/commencement by April 30.

Brainfuse Online Tutoring can be accessed through Blackboard Log into your Blackboard account. Click on your course under My Courses. On the left side of the screen, click Brainfuse Online Tutor. Click Brainfuse HelpNow button.
